Faculty and Staffs by Occupation at Parkland College

A total of 638 employees, including instructional and non-instructional, both full-time and part-time status work at Parkland College. By employment type, there are 403 full-time and 235 part-time faculties and staffs. By gender, 339 female and 299 male employees are working at Parkland.

The number of instructional staffs (i.e. teaching faculty) is 352, which is 55.17% of total employees. On average, 15 students are in a class or assigned per a faculty. By occupation, there are 30 Librarians, 24 management occupation, 37 computer/engineering, and 53 service occupations.

By race/ethnicity, there are 500 white (78.37%), 50 black (7.84%), and 19 asian (2.98%) employees working at Parkland. A total of 2 non-resident alien employees work at Parkland.

Employment Status

According to the IPEDS, Full-time staff and Part-time staff is determined by the institution. The type of appointment at the snapshot date determines whether an employee is full time or part time. The employee\s term of contract is not considered in making the determination of full or part time. Casual employees (hired on an ad-hoc basis or occasional basis to meet short-term needs) and students in the College Work-Study Program (CWS) are not considered part-time staff.
